1 / 1

What is selenium Explain its benefits in software testing

Selenium has proved to be one of the best test automation tools for testing web applications and a lot of organizations have immensely benefitted from it.<br>https://www.testingxperts.com/blog/selenium-testing

garryrachel
Télécharger la présentation

What is selenium Explain its benefits in software testing

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. What is selenium? Explain its benefits in software testing Selenium has proved to be one of the best test automation tools for testing web applications and a lot of organizations have immensely benefitted from it. Developers and testers have embraced the selenium tool and have leveraged it for improving their specific software testing activities and the outcome, as usual, has been rewarding and beneficial. The biggest advantage of selenium is that it supports multiple programming languages, various browsers and operating system platforms and thus it is considered to be highly compatible. In this article, you will get to know selenium along with its advantages. What is Selenium? It is an open-source test automation tool that is exclusively used for testing web applications. It has a huge online community of selenium enthusiasts where a plethora of selenium related material and information is available. Selenium test scripts can be written in popular programming languages such as Perl, PHP, Java, C#, Ruby, Python etc. Selenium comes with a suite of tools that can be exclusively used for different projects. The selenium suite has four tools namely Selenium Integrated Development Environment (IDE), Selenium Remote Control (RC), Selenium WebDriver and Selenium Grid. Following are the the five key benefits of selenium test automation tool: 01 05 02 03 04 Selenium is compatible with various operating systems Selenium supports multiple browsers and programming languages The It is an open-source tool Easy to Value of reusability implement 1. Selenium is compatible with various operating systems: Organizations use different operating systems depending upon the software project they are involved in, and hence an automation tool that supports all the operating systems will prove to be worthwhile. Selenium is a portable tool that can easily work with different operating systems such as Unix, macOS, Linux, Windows etc. The Selenium test suite can be created on any of the above listed operating system platforms and then the same test suite can also be executed on a different OS platform. Through this, test automation scripts can be easily written by testers and developers without focusing on the platform that needs to be used. 2. Selenium supports multiple browsers and programming languages: The selenium community has focused on ensuring that one selenium script can run and execute on various browsers. Selenium is highly compatible with various browsers such as Internet Explorer, Safari, Chrome, Firefox, Edge and Opera. Scripts need not be written for every browser. Just one selenium script can work on all the browsers as mentioned above. Selenium test scripts can be easily written in popular programming languages such as Java, C#, PHP, Python, Perl etc. 3. It is an open-source tool: The key benefit of this highly efficient tool is the availability of open-source. It is publicly accessible and is free for use, with no costs involved. The selenium community is devoted to helping software engineers and developers in automating web browser functionalities and features. The code can be customized for better code management and the functionality of predefined classes and functions is enhanced. 4. Easy to implement: Selenium is an easy-to-use tool. Test scripts can be created and executed easily and effectively as it provides a user-friendly interface. Detailed reports of selenium tests can be analyzed by the team and further evaluation can be done based on the analysis. 5. The value of reusability: As selenium automation test suites are reusable, they can be tested across various operating systems and multiple browsers. The condition is that selenium should be an all-inclusive web automation testing tool. In order to broaden the scope of testing, add-ons and third-party frameworks are needed. For example, selenium can be integrated with JUnit and TestNG for generating reports and managing test cases. CONCLUSION If you are looking forward to implementing selenium testing for your specific software development project, then do visit online a highly rewarding software testing services company that will provide you strategic advice along with tactical and proven testing strategies that are in line with your project specific requirements. www.TestingXperts.com To know more about our services please email us at info@testingxperts.com USA | CANADA | UK | NETHERLANDS | INDIA | SINGAPORE | SOUTH AFRICA © 2022 TestingXperts, All Rights Reserved © www.testingxperts.com

More Related